Jamba Juice is a popular chain of smoothie and juice stores that has been in operation since 1990. Over the years, the company has grown to over 800 locations in the United States and internationally, making it a well-known and respected brand in the health food industry.
The stock price of Jamba Juice has fluctuated significantly over the years, reflecting the ups and downs of the company's financial performance and the overall stock market. In the past, Jamba Juice's stock price has been impacted by a variety of factors, including changes in consumer demand for healthy food options, competition from other companies in the industry, and the overall state of the economy.
One of the main drivers of Jamba Juice's stock price has been the company's financial performance. In recent years, Jamba Juice has struggled with declining sales and profits, which has led to a decline in the stock price. However, the company has implemented various strategies to try to turn things around, including expanding its menu offerings, increasing its presence in international markets, and streamlining its operations. If these efforts are successful, it could potentially lead to an increase in the stock price.
Another factor that has impacted Jamba Juice's stock price is competition from other companies in the industry. The health food sector is highly competitive, with many companies vying for market share. As a result, Jamba Juice has faced intense competition from other smoothie and juice chains, which has put pressure on the company's financial performance and stock price.
Finally, the overall state of the economy can also impact Jamba Juice's stock price. When the economy is doing well and consumer confidence is high, people may be more likely to spend money on non-essential items like smoothies and juices. Conversely, when the economy is struggling and consumer confidence is low, people may be more hesitant to spend money on these types of items, which could impact Jamba Juice's sales and stock price.
